PRIVACY CLAUSE. The Contractor shall, at all times, maintain confidential all information pertaining to any person, patient, or client with whom it has a professional relationship, contact or contract. No information shall be released to any person or party not directly employed by the Contractor without first obtaining such person's, patient's or client's expressed written consent therefore. Confidential information pertaining to any minor shall not be released to any person or party without the express written consent of a custodial parent, court appointed guardian, court authorized xxxxxx parent, or authorized self- consenting minor, subject however, to all applicable state and federal statues, rules and regulations.
